Output 21c3b1fe1606f58bd645f02268dd0cc5745b864cc1f65b5dd005e38356535069:3

value
60578384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e855546910bd70073539e3ac98710ebc2cfd8676 OP_EQUAL
address
MV5dDkMXXYJHJKqH5gbhh1fGjN2gnCnRC6
transaction
21c3b1fe1606f58bd645f02268dd0cc5745b864cc1f65b5dd005e38356535069
spent
true